JGRMX/Yoshimura/Suzuki Factory Racing Announces 2019 Supercross Team

 

Chad Reed Is Back 

 

When Anaheim 1 rolls around look for the return of Chad Reed as part of the powerhouse JGRMX/Yoshimura/Suzuki squad. Suzuki Motor of America, Inc. (SMAI) and JGRMX/Yoshimura/Suzuki Factory Racing are contesting the 2019 Monster Energy Supercross series with two-time 450 Supercross Champ Reed and Justin Hill. In addition, Alex Martin will join Jimmy Decotis, Kyle Peters, and Enzo Lopes in the 250 class. The four-rider 250 program will race with the all-new 2019 Suzuki RM-Z250.

 

Fan-favorite 450 rider Weston Peick will also be returning to the JGRMX/Yoshimura/Suzuki stable for his fifth year after he heals up. A crash at the Paris Supercross in November left him multiple facial injuries, Peick will not be competing until he is healthy and ready. In the meantime, he will be signing autographs and meeting fans at various SX venues.

 

Chad Reed (#22) is fourth on the all-time Supercross win list, with 44 main event victories. The 36-year-old had a busy off-season, sweeping the S-X Open in New Zealand and capturing the International FIM Oceania Championship. He looks to carry that success into 2019.
